Adding Your Blog Feed to Twitter
We all use Twitter to keep in contact with our friends and frequently sent idle chat between one another, but we can use Twitter to send our RSS feeds too, by using twitterfeed we can automatically update our followers of our latest posts from our blog by RSS feeds without lifting a finger.
Before we go though the setting up , you will need two things:
1. A twitter account, if you don’t have your account click here to sign up
2. You will require an OpenID account (you may use your yahoo OpenID)

Having now got your twitter account and OpenID set up we are ready to sign up for Twitterfeed, Here are the steps :
- As mentioned set up your Twitter account, and login into twitterfeed with your OpenID (if you use Yahoo then use your login profile information)
- Now set up your Twitterfeed account and add your RSS feed URL as per your blog. (e.g. http://feeds.feedburner.com/YMMJ)
- You may add more than one RSS feed to your Twitterfeed account.
- Select your update frequency, you may update your followers from 30minutes to 24 hours depending on your preference.
- You can set the number of updates each time.
- You can list the post title or the description.
- You have option to add prefix, which is helpful if you have more than one blog in your twitterfeed account.

Now you can update your account and the RSS feed is set up, it only took less than 15 minutes and now you can enjoy the benefits that come with having an increased audience.
